Pair Trading with Goosehead Insurance and American Eagle
The main advantage of trading using opposite Goosehead Insurance and American Eagle positions is that it hedges away some unsystematic risk. Because of two separate transactions, even if Goosehead Insurance position performs unexpectedly, American Eagle can make up some of the losses. Pair trading also minimizes risk from directional movements in the market.
